Jérôme Kerviel – the trader who hid €50 billion in trades at a major international bank – and his former superiors reveal all sides of the scandal. Discover "Breaking the Bank: One Trader, 50 Billion" a captivating documentary tv show that first graced the screens in 2024. This production, originating from France features contributions from Jérôme Kerviel in the role of Lui-même.
